Has anyone done tuning for a 2015 engine in a 2011 truck? Do you have to change out any sensors? I Need a new engine for my 2011 & there is a low km 2015 available.


I've worked with strategy conversions during testing. We could certainly make a file that would work with it.

Do keep in mind that the ECM pinout is a bit different with the fuel temp sensor and fuel pressure switch. Those would need altering to function. Not sure of SCT or MCC would be capable of converting or not.

Edit to add: if you were to keep some of the top end components of your current engine and use the 2015 long block, it could be simply treated as a 2011 vehicle with a 15 turbo and pump conversion, which is easy.

I just put a 2015 motor in a 2011. Still waiting on the tunes to arrive from *******, but just driving on the 40hp and the 165hp im pretty thrilled. Customer bought an 11 with a bent rod and found a used low mile 15 motor that was burnt up. We swapped all the sensors from the 11 to the 15 and got new injectors for it since the orginal ones were a little hot.
